![]() Thaddeus Spae's compositions have been featured on National Public Radio, Showtime cable television and Broadway, choreographed by the Paul Taylor Dance Troupe and recorded for broadcast by the BBC. He has performed at venues from Tipitina's in New Orleans to the EMP in Seattle, and at numerous fairs and festivals including Bumbershoot, the Oregon Country Fair, and the Sawdust Festival. Thaddeus is a founding participant in the nationally-known Seattle City Parks Buskers program, and an award-winner and seven-time finalist at the Tumbleweed Folk Festival songwriting competition. |
